33-Year-Old Man Fatally Struck in Pedestrian Accident near McDowell Road

PHOENIX, AZ (June 29, 2023) – Early Tuesday morning, Robert Davis was killed in a pedestrian collision on Interstate 17. Authorities responded to the scene around 3:00 a.m., near McDowell Road on May 30th. Per reports, the driver of a vehicle struck 33-year-old Davis and immediately fled the scene. According to the Arizona DPS, 33-year-old Davis was struck by a vehicle in the area which later led to his death. Furthermore, the authorities found the driver in a short distance from the scene. He remained and cooperated with the deputies. Consequently, the officers blocked all southbound lanes of the freeway during the duration of the investigation. It was later reopened by 6:00 a.m. Meanwhile, the officers stated that suicide is suspected and was not ruled out as a possible factor. Following the events, no arrests or charges were filed. The crash is still under investigation.
